THE SECTION QUARTET

Fuzzbox

2007-08-13

Touted as “The Loudest String Quintet on the Planet,” they’ve been a great resource over the years in Los Angeles to rock bands that need a string backup on albums, concerts, or television appearances. They’ve played with many big names. These guys are a rock band that just happen to play strings. The album includes covers of The Strokes, Radiohead, Queens of the Stone Age, The Yeah Yeah Yeahs, Led Zepelin, Soundgarden, and Massive Attack. – Pete
